The Science Behind Dog Whining

Dog whining is a way of communication that is common in all breeds. It is a high-pitched sound that can signify a wide range of emotions such as fear, anxiety, excitement, or distress. Whining is a natural behavior for dogs, and it can be triggered by different factors such as socialization, training, and environmental factors.

According to research, whining is an evolutionary trait that has been inherited by dogs from their wolf ancestors. Wolves whine to communicate with their pack, and dogs have retained this behavior to communicate with their owners. Dogs have a unique ability to detect changes in their owners’ physical and emotional state, which can trigger their whining behavior.

What Triggers Your Dog’s Whining?

There are several triggers that can cause your dog to whine, including hunger, thirst, boredom, anxiety, pain, or discomfort. It is essential to identify the cause of your dog’s whining behavior to address it properly. Some dogs whine when they want attention or affection from their owners, while others whine when they feel threatened or uncomfortable.

If your dog whines when you kiss your boyfriend, it could be because they feel anxious or uncomfortable around him. Dogs are territorial animals, and they can become protective of their owners. They may perceive your boyfriend as a threat to their territory or their bond with you, which can trigger their whining behavior.

The Relationship Between Dogs and Affection

Dogs are social animals that thrive on affection and attention from their owners. They have a unique ability to detect changes in their owners’ emotional state and respond accordingly. When you show affection to your boyfriend in front of your dog, they may perceive it as a threat to their bond with you. This can trigger their whining behavior as a way of seeking your attention or expressing their discomfort.

It is important to note that dogs have different personalities and respond to affection differently. Some dogs enjoy being cuddled and kissed, while others prefer to have their space. It is important to understand your dog’s personality and respect their boundaries when it comes to affection.

The Importance of Socialization and Training

Socialization and training are essential for dogs’ overall well-being and behavior. Socialization involves exposing your dog to different environments, people, and animals to help them become more comfortable and confident in social situations. Training involves teaching your dog basic commands and obedience to ensure their safety and well-being.

Proper socialization and training can help your dog feel comfortable around your boyfriend and reduce their whining behavior. It is important to introduce your boyfriend to your dog gradually and in a positive manner. You can reward your dog for good behavior and gradually increase the duration and frequency of their interactions.

Signs Your Dog is Uncomfortable with Your Boyfriend

It is important to observe your dog’s behavior around your boyfriend and identify any signs of discomfort or anxiety. Some signs that your dog may be uncomfortable around your boyfriend include:

  • Whining, growling, or barking
  • Avoiding or hiding
  • Pacing or restlessness
  • Licking or biting themselves excessively
  • Aggression or territorial behavior

If you notice any of these signs, it is important to address them immediately and seek professional help if necessary.

The Role of Positive Reinforcement in Training

Positive reinforcement is a training technique that involves rewarding good behavior with treats and praise. This technique is effective in training dogs and can help address their whining behavior. By rewarding good behavior, you can reinforce positive habits and reduce negative behavior.

It is important to use positive reinforcement consistently and avoid punishing your dog for bad behavior. Punishment can cause anxiety and aggression in dogs and can worsen their behavior.

When to Seek Professional Help

If your dog’s whining behavior persists despite your efforts to address it, it may be time to seek professional help. A professional dog trainer or behaviorist can help identify the cause of your dog’s behavior and address it appropriately. They can also provide you with training techniques and tools to help manage your dog’s behavior.
